Loading

剑指 Offer 64. 求1+2+…+n

 

 

思路

方法:使用逻辑&&运算符的短路特性终止递归

1 class Solution {
2 public:
3     int sumNums(int n) {
4         n > 1 && (n += sumNums(n - 1));
5         return n;
6     }
7 };

 

posted @ 2020-11-15 19:41  拾月凄辰  阅读(78)  评论(0编辑  收藏  举报